Smokin' Snow's Bbq & More

Call
101 N Missouri Ave
Salem, IL 62881

Smokin' Snow's BBQ & More is a local eatery in Salem, IL that specializes in serving up delicious barbecue dishes.

With a menu offering a variety of smoked meats and classic sides, this establishment provides a casual dining experience for patrons looking to enjoy hearty comfort food.

Generated from their business information

Also at this address

Own this business?
See a problem?
United StatesIllinoisSalemSmokin' Snow's Bbq & More